Overall Highlights

  • Nicolás Maduro has been detained, leading to significant political upheaval in Venezuela.
  • Maria Corina Machado has met with Donald Trump, presenting him with her Nobel Peace Prize, indicating a shift in U.S.-Venezuelan relations.
  • Delcy Rodríguez, the acting president, has announced reforms in the oil sector following Maduro’s capture, signaling potential changes in governance.
  • The U.S. has seized multiple Venezuelan oil tankers as part of ongoing sanctions and has begun purchasing oil from Venezuela post-Maduro’s detention.
  • There is a notable divide in perspectives on U.S. actions, with Venezuelan sources condemning them as terrorism, while U.S. sources view them as necessary sanctions.
